St. James School (Closed 2010)

St. James School has always been a crossroads for multiple communities, and the School reflects the diversity of New York City.
Our students are enriched by the wealth of backgrounds of their classmates.
Today, the school serves Pre-K through eighth grade students who live in the surrounding Chinatown neighborhood, as well as students of parents who work in the City Hall area, at Verizon, One Police Plaza, and numerous Federal and state buildings and courthouses.
About half of our students commute from outside the Lower East Side, mostly from Brooklyn.
As a small Catholic school with 1 class per grade, St.
James feels like a close-knit family. At St. James, we believe that each student has the potential to achieve and succeed.
With an average class size of 24 students, all children are offered the individual attention they deserve in a constructive, nurturing, and safe environment.
